Cry in the Night by Colleen Coble is a reprint edition published by Harper Collins in 2013, featuring 320 pages in English. This novel follows Bree Matthews, a search-and-rescue worker, who, along with her dog Samson, discovers a crying infant in the snowy woods of Rock Harbor, Michigan. As Bree takes the baby girl into her care, she embarks on a quest to find the child’s mother, who has been reported missing, unraveling a mystery that intertwines with her own past.

Readers will find a blend of mystery, suspense, and romance as Bree investigates the circumstances surrounding the abandoned baby. The narrative delves into her search for answers, exploring connections to her first husband’s mysterious death years earlier. With themes of women sleuths and Christian elements, this book presents a compelling story of discovery and the complexities of life, all sparked by the haunting sound of a cry in the night.

Bree and Samson discover a crying infant in the snowy Rock Harbor forest. But where are the baby’s parents And how did she get there

A mysterious sound leads search-and-rescue worker Bree Matthews and her dog Samson to an abandoned baby in the woods outside Rock Harbor, Michigan. Bree takes the baby girl in and begins to search for the mother–presumably the woman reported missing just days earlier.

While teams scour the wintery forests, Bree ferrets out clues about the woman. Where is she and why did she leave the child behind And how does that connect to Bree’s first husband’s mysterious death years ago in the Upper Peninsula Everything Bree thought she knew about her life changes with the sound of a cry in the night.
